# Suffix-based resolution of names Any unique name suffix can be used to refer to a definition. For instance: ```unison -- No imports needed even though FQN is `builtin.{Int,Nat}` foo.bar.a : Int foo.bar.a = +99 -- No imports needed even though FQN is `builtin.Optional.{None,Some}` optional.isNone o = case o of None -> true Some _ -> false ``` This also affects commands like find. Notice lack of qualified names in output: ```ucm .> find take ``` In the signature, we don't see `base.Nat`, just `Nat`. The full declaration name is still shown for each search result though. Type-based search also benefits from this, we can just say `Nat` rather than `.base.Nat`: ```ucm .> find : Nat -> [a] -> [a] ```
